Description

Context Nestled in the Middle Lozoya Valley, at the foot of the Somosierra Pass, lies the Centro Hípico Buitrago, a riding center with over 18 years of experience in equestrian activities. Here, the natural landscape blends rural trails with panoramic views of the Medieval Village of Buitrago and the Sierra de Guadarrama, creating a serene atmosphere where the scent of forest and river breeze accompany every step.

The Experience During a private 45- to 60-minute lesson, you’ll learn to ride and guide Lusitanian horses or foals suited to your skill level. Guided by a certified instructor, you’ll improve your balance and posture while listening to the rhythm of hooves and the whisper of wind through trees. Personalized attention and mandatory helmet use ensure a safe, educational, and enjoyable session.

For Whom Perfect for children from age 5, complete beginners, and intermediate riders aiming to refine technique. Not suitable for individuals with strong fear of horses or those unable to wear a helmet.

Local Context The center is part of a longstanding equestrian community preserving the traditions of the Northern Madrid Sierra. It offers guided rides across historic farms and old trails, where nature and cultural heritage intertwine seamlessly.

Expert Recommendations

Wear comfortable clothing and closed-toe shoes suitable for horseback riding. A helmet is required and provided by the center. Book in advance to secure your spot, and avoid midday heat during summer—opt for morning or late afternoon sessions. Check the weather forecast to prepare appropriate clothing and adjust expectations accordingly.

About the Area

Buitrago del Lozoya is located in the Northern Sierra of Madrid, surrounded by natural beauty and historical heritage. Near the riding center, you can explore the Medieval Village, walk marked hiking trails, or enjoy water-based activities along the Lozoya River. The area features local restaurants serving regional cuisine and basic amenities, all accessible by car from Madrid.
